EBM Acquiring Best Evidence
Session Description: Practicing evidence-based medicine is an important aspect of providing good medical care. Accessing external information through literature searches on computer-based systems can effectively achieve integration in clinical care. In this session, we will build on skills learned in InFOCUS 5 and practice creating effective clinical questions and explore pre-appraised databases to find the answers.

Learning Objectives: At the end of this session, the student learners will:
- Develop an unfocused question into a structured clinical question.
- Be able to explain what a pre-appraised resource is and its utility.
- Use a pre-appraised resource to find evidence to answer a clinical question.
